Abstract

The utility model relates to a waste line cutting device which implements the cutting treatment for a plurality of waste lines winding on a take-up wheel and comprises a mobile part and a fixed part. Wherein a traveling drive device, a take-up wheel steering device and a lead screw are arranged on a machine frame to form the mobile part; a cutting device, a road rail and a lead screw nut are fixed on a bedplate to form the fixed part. A motor of the traveling drive device drives the lead screw of the lower part of the machine frame to rotate through a transmission, and inserts the lead screw into the lead screw nut fixed in the bedplate to make the machine frame travel. The motor of the cutting device drives a grinding wheel blade to rotate and cut the take-up wheel arranged on the take-up wheel steering device, and the hand wheel rotary screw controls the upper and lower feed amount of the grinding wheel. The lower part of the machine frame is provided with four wheels matched with the road rail. The waste line cutting machine also can fix the traveling drive device and the lead screw on the bedplate and arrange the lead screw nut on the machine frame for the configuration. The technical scheme has the simple structure, the high degree of mechanization, the quick cutting speed and the high efficiency, and is easy to reduce and avoid the damage of the cutting powder dust on the human health.

Description

The scrap wire cutting machine
(1) technical field
The utility model is a kind of specific purpose tool of machining occasion, particularly relates to a kind of scrap wire shearing device that the scrap wire that is wrapped in a large number on the bobbin is cut off processing.
(2) background technology
Known, more and more thinner to the requirement of semiconductor silicon sheet material thickness in the production of silicon solar cell along with information technology and development of electronic technology, to reduce the cost of raw material and product weight.
Manufacturer is a purpose to improve specific yield and enterprise profit, simplifies production technology and reduces waste sludge discharge, reduces cost, and therefore at present increasing semi-conducting material manufacturing enterprise adopts multi-thread cutting to replace conventional interior circle cutting.
Multi-thread cutting processing is the metal wire with superfine belt grinding mortar, evenly is arranged in the enclosed shape gauze thick and fast by guide wheel, and many bars relatively move in gauze, is cut into a kind of processing method of thin slice synchronously.
The line that is arranged in gauze is a hundreds of km, even the metal wire of thousands of kms, metal wire can not re-use after winding behind the synchronous cutting silicon rod material is recovered to take-up pulley, and take-up pulley is important part on the equipment, need to use repeatedly, therefore, unload after the scrap wire of intensive winding must being cut off, just can make take-up pulley repeat to be used.Prior art is to adopt that mode is to intensive winding manually, and layer upon layer of scrap wire cuts, during because of cutting powder too conference injure health, and hand cut is thick, heavy scrap wire, its labour intensity is very big, and cutting speed is slow, efficient is low.
(3) summary of the invention
The purpose of this utility model intends providing a kind of releases artificial direct cutting operation, the special-purpose machinery that scrap wire is cut off by machinery.
The purpose of this utility model so realizes.
A kind of scrap wire cutting machine is made of in two sub-sections movable part and fixed part.
Travel driving unit, take-up pulley transfer and leading screw are installed in and have constituted movable part on the frame.Cutter sweep, two tracks and a feed screw nut are fixed on the standing part that has constituted a kind of scrap wire cutting machine on the platen.
Travel driving unit as power, via speed changer output, drives the leading screw rotation of frame lower by motor, leading screw penetrates the feed screw nut that is fixed on the platen, leading screw rotation on frame, feed screw nut is fixing different, and then frame is advanced with respect to platen or is retreated mobile.
The take-up pulley transfer is made up of worm and gear steering gear and take-up pulley plug, the take-up pulley plug is connected on the worm gear and swings synchronously with worm gear, when the take-up pulley plug is horizontal, the below of take-up pulley plug is the rewinding dish, the top of take-up pulley plug is the grinding wheel of cutter sweep, the axis of take-up pulley plug and grinding wheel and are parallel to each other on same vertical plane.
The driven by motor grinding wheel of cutter sweep, the screw rod rotation control grinding wheel bottom and top feed of handwheel.
Four wheels of frame lower configuration and track are complementary, can be along the track walking of accurately advancing and retreat.The both sides tipping trammer handle of frame is used for hand push and moves.
During use, worm screw on the manual or electronic rotation take-up pulley transfer, make the take-up pulley plug straight up, the intensive take-up pulley that has twined scrap wire is inserted in the take-up pulley plug, shaking worm screw rotates the take-up pulley plug gradually, until the accumbency horizontal level, make the wire-blocking board secant notch of take-up pulley aim at grinding wheel towards the top.
Frame is pushed into the track mouth, wheel aligns track, the leading screw of frame inserts in the feed screw nut that is fixed on the platen of ground, handwheel on the rotary cutting apparatus, the screw acting of hand wheel shaft, make the grinding wheel on the cutter sweep adjust to suitable height, start grinding wheel drive mitor and frame drive motors, frame carries waits to cut off the take-up pulley of scrap wire along track, also promptly walk forward along the direction of rotation of emery wheel wheel sheet, the sand sheet of rotation has cut off the layer upon layer of scrap wire that meets at a high speed, and the scrap wire of disconnection becomes scattered about in the rewinding dish of take-up pulley transfer below.Close emery wheel, withdraw from frame backward, rotary worm makes the take-up pulley plug go back to vertical position, takes out and has cut the take-up bye wheel carrier of finishing scrap wire, collects the cataclasm scrap wire in the rewinding dish, and this operation is finished.
Frame both sides attaching trammer handle, when frame not in orbit, when the wheel of frame is in free state, manually promote trammer handle, this frame can be used as transport trolley, travels to and fro between silicon rod wire cutting machine and scrap wire and cuts off between the place.
Can remove this and install fixed bedplate component, the parts on the relevant standing part are directly installed on the ground, normal operation equally, and saved a large-scale platen, reduce installation cost.
Same principle can be fixed on a part that forms on the platen in the scrap wire cutting machine standing part with travel driving unit and leading screw.Feed screw nut is installed in a part that forms on the frame in the movable part.
During use, frame is pushed into the track mouth, wheel aligns track, feed screw nut on the frame is inserted on the leading screw that is fixed on the platen of ground, start the motor that is fixed on travel driving unit on the platen, driving leading screw rotation, index feed screw nut has been installed frame along leading screw, also promptly walk forward along track.Make that the take-up pulley of take-up pulley transfer produces relative motion on the grinding wheel of cutter sweep on the platen and the frame, scrap wire is cut.
Like this structure, travel driving unit is installed on the fixing platen, and that can avoid power line drags influence back and forth, and more nimble, safety is operated in the heavy burden that alleviates walked frame.
This device can be removed fixed platen, and the parts on the relevant standing part are directly installed on ground, also can play same purpose, and save a large-scale platen.
Adopt the device of technical solutions of the utility model, simple in structure, avoid cutting the infringement of powder thereby make operating personnel when cutting, can leave to health, cutting speed is fast, cutting efficiency is high.
Attaching air-drafting and dust-removing device above cutoff wheel can further reduce and eliminate the pollution of cutting dust.
